WebFeb 15, 2024 · The speed of sound is dependent upon the medium it travels through, so the speed of sound is different in water (1500 m/s) and air (343 m/s). Sound travels by transmitting energy to neighboring molecules, so the denser the medium, the faster the waves travel. Atmoshpheric Noise. Atmospheric noise, which is also called static, is produced by lightning discharges in thunderstorms and other natural electrical disturbances which occur in the atmosphere. These electric impulses are random in nature. disney dreamlight valley cloud log indisney dreamlight valley clay farmingWebAny undesirable electrical energy that falls within the passband of the signal.
